Are teams always this careful with people coming off the World Cup?
I mean, the way some of these commentators talk about Germans like Ozil, Mertesacker, Podolski, you'd think the WC just ended a couple weeks ago. They've had well over a month now, does it really wipe them out that much?
They've really only had a month or so off in the last calendar year. That's a lot of wear & tear on their legs. It's why KD & Bron took this summer off, basically to recharge their batteries. Not only that but guys are more likely to get seriously injured when they're less than 100%.
2 years ago all the games that Oscar played really wore him down and he was clearly not the same player in YR2 compared to YR1.
